- [ ] **Step 7: Breaker override escrow.** After sealing the signing keys for the Tallgrove upstream API circuit breaker, confirm the support team can force the breaker open during a full outage. The override bundle lives in the sealed escrow drawer and is useless without its unlock phrase. Two ceremony witnesses must initial this step before proceeding. The escrow bundle is decrypted with the recovery passphrase that follows.

vault phrase of kahip-kahop = holath-quenmir

## Service Accounts: GarageSense Occupancy Feed

The occupancy feed for the Deckerton garages runs under a dedicated service account with read-only scope on the sensor aggregation API. The account is rotated every 60 days and its activity is logged to the central audit sink. For review purposes, the currently active key for the internal feed endpoint follows.

gateway credential: vxb4-QTMv

☐ Step 7 — Bounce processor signing key rotation. Before sealing the Marletta envelope, confirm the Driftpost bounce processor has drained its retry queue and that the old DKIM-adjacent signing key is marked retired in the Covewall registry. Two witnesses from the Harrowfen ops rotation must initial the ledger. Future maintainers: do not skip the drain check — a mid-rotation bounce can wedge the classifier for hours. Once both initials are recorded, the recovery passphrase below is read aloud once and stored.

vault phrase of bafop-kahop = sormir-frador

## 4.0.0 — Changed defaults

The Copperstack build has migrated to the Hermetica build system. Network access during builds is now disabled by default, and all plugin toolchains resolve from the pinned manifest rather than the host. Plugins relying on ambient compilers will fail until updated. New builds use the following default configuration.

settings of tagef-bawif:
DRUIX_HOST=druix.zemvarlabs.internal
DRUIX_PORT=8000